Borderlands 4 Characters Have Bigger Skill Trees Than the Previous Two Games Combined

Gearbox CEO Randy Pitchford had taken the stage through the Borderlands Fan Fest to disclose just a few extra particulars about Borderlands 4. Whereas Pitchford spoke fairly a bit about varied facets of the upcoming co-op looter shooter, together with its playable characters, he additionally revealed that the ability bushes in Borderlands 4 would be the largest we’ve seen within the franchise to this point.

As caught by GamesRadar, Pitchford, together with Gearbox chief inventive officer Randy Varnell, revealed {that a} single Borderlands 4 character can have extra abilities of their ability bushes than any characters from Borderlands 2 and Borderlands 3 mixed. It’s value noting that, historically, Borderlands video games haven’t had huge ability bushes like, say, Path of Exile, for instance. Nonetheless, the titles have allowed for fairly a little bit of customisation by its smaller ability bushes regardless.

“You’ll discover extra abilities per character than in Borderlands 3 and 2 added collectively,” stated Pitchford, happening to joke that, “We’re working late on Fridays for you.” Pitchford’s line was a follow-up to Varnell’s rationalization that the ability tree presents sufficient selection to permit 4 gamers enjoying the identical character to nonetheless find yourself with differing play kinds.

For context, Borderlands 2’s characters had 10 abilities in every of their ability bushes, whereas Borderlands 3’s characters had between 18 and 20 abilities in every tree. This may imply {that a} single character in Borderlands 4 may find yourself with greater than 30 completely different abilities in a single tree, which might give gamers loads of choices when it got here to increase their characters.

Earlier this week, lead author Taylor Clark and govt Chris Brock additionally revealed some particulars about Borderlands 4. In an interview, Clark spoke about how the inventive workforce behind Borderlands has developed with the instances, whereas Brock revealed that gamers can have fairly a little bit of freedom in what order they resolve to tackle the sport’s major story missions.

“Borderlands is sort of sufficiently old to drive. It might be unusual if it weren’t consistently rising and adapting,” stated Clark. “We’re a inventive workforce, and there are concepts that we wish to specific by Borderlands 4; ways in which we wish to make it really feel like we’re breaking contemporary floor once more.”

Brock, alternatively, spoke about how the truth that Borderlands 4 severely cuts down on the loading instances over its predecessor implies that gamers have much more freedom to finish the primary marketing campaign’s missions in “just about any order.” He additionally talked about that sport design had a centered strategy on the upcoming title’s motion and exploration.

Throughout Borderlands Fan Fest, Gearbox had additionally launched a brand new trailer for Borderlands 4, this time round specializing in the shooter’s story, and the way the Vault Hunters will become involved with the Crimson Resistance to free Kairos from the Timekeeper.

Borderlands 4 is coming to PC, PS5, Xbox Sequence X/S and Nintendo Swap 2. Whereas the primary three platforms will likely be getting it on September 12, the Swap 2 model is slated for launch down the highway. The sport is priced at $69.99.
